Output 401658d56c320ff955ff53f4a2d91d2928b9961e9f6c621a5da5a7fa129502ba:3

value
17020000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5aa7037cb570aa0922541cd73ee42582d1cc72ad OP_EQUALVERIFY OP_CHECKSIG
address
19GKtaKypwGMFKm6gCZt1xa4FNAd5v7RaL
transaction
401658d56c320ff955ff53f4a2d91d2928b9961e9f6c621a5da5a7fa129502ba
spent
true